What is Encryption in Use?
Traditional data encryption solutions leave data exposed at critical points in its lifecycle. Paperclip SAFE ensures continuous encryption across every data state, including encryption in use. Whereas traditional solutions decrypt data while in a production environment, Paperclip SAFE enables data use without ever decrypting, exposing it to threats or slowing down your business.
